On Saturday, October 30, 2021, Essie Justice Group joined Black Lives Matter-LA, Dignity and Power Now, Muslim ARC and the Check the Sheriff Coalition for the Rally for Stolen Lives. Ms. Khadijah, an Essie Sister, led this powerful rally in demanding justice, transparency, and police accountability. Ms. Khadijah’s loved one, Dana Mitchell Young Jr. aka Malik, was killed last year by Los Angeles Sheriff’s Department and has been fighting for justice since.
 
“Dana was my adopted son…He was also a brother, a friend, a cousin, a nephew,” Ms. Khadijah said at the Saturday rally. “For me, this rally is all about standing up. And standing up and for people who have been bullied or mistreated. And in this case, standing up against law enforcement responsible for taking our loved ones. If you have ever felt separated, or if you’ve ever felt isolated or felt that you had no voice, we’re here to fight for you today. We fight for us.”
